New report shows that research gender gap is closing, but not for women inventors
The gender gap in research is narrowing, according to a sweeping new report by Elsevier that examined research participation, career progression and perceptions in 43 countries, including Canada, through a gender lens. But despite some gains, women still represent a tiny minority of all inventors.

Simon Fraser University partners with B.C.’S First Nations Health Authority to support Indigenous research
The new Research Affiliation Agreement is the of its kind between FNHA and an academic institution. The agreement is designed to overcome barriers to access to funding, and will share 50 per cent of funds that SFU receives for research that impacts the health of First Nations communities.

Eddyfi in Quebec expands global reach with back-to-back acquisitions
Eddyfi has acquired two overseas companies that expand the Quebec City-based tech firm’s capability and reach in the fest-growing global market for non-destructive technologies and services. More than $600 million in private equity and debt financing was raised to complete the acquisitions and pursue other strategic opportunities.
Canada strengthens ties to global science with new funds for EU research collaboration
A $10-million program to support Canadian researchers participating in Horizon 2020, the European Union’s flagship research funding program, could lead to much closer, long-term research ties between Canada and the EU.
